Somebody brought the following Alice sentence to my attention:

 no’i la ciftoldi ku joi la alis ze’a simxu le nu smaji catlu (older version)
 no'i la ciftoldi joi la .alis. ze'a simxu lo nu smaji catlu (newer version)

Why "joi", given that "ce" would be in more accordance with the
dictionary definition of simxu1 (a set)? I'm personally of the opinion
that the dictionary doesn't have to confine this x1 to one type or the
other; but if it's just that we don't have to be as much strict about
what makes for simxu1, why not "ju'e", which presumably is already
generic?

Another concern is about KOhA involving "joi". "mi'o", for example:

 http://jbovlaste.lojban.org/dict/mi%27o

My understanding:

 ci mi'o
 = ci lo me mi joi do
 = ci da poi me mi joi do

My question: Does this "da" refer to lo gunma or lo se gunma? In other
words, is each of the three referents of "ci da" a group or an
individual?
